Reading the Canada work permit figure

Employer-specific and open permits diverge early

A Canadian work permit may be employer-specific or open, and the two follow different paths. Employer-specific permits usually depend on a labour market assessment or an exemption established beforehand, so the employer's steps precede the applicant's and are invisible in any figure describing the permit itself.

Figures given by country and permit type

Published figures are given by country of application and by permit type, and they describe processing after a complete application is received. Work permits issued at a port of entry, where eligibility allows it, are not described by these figures at all.

Biometrics, medicals, and an employer step that expired

Biometrics that have not been given, or medicals that have not been completed where the intended work requires one, hold a file without any officer needing to act. Applications from countries with heavier volume take longer for reasons unrelated to the individual case. Where a permit depends on an employer step that has expired, the application waits on the employer rather than on the department.
